Insulation pins for fire sprinkler systems are critical components that help to maintain the integrity and effectiveness of these life-saving systems. Fire sprinkler systems are designed to detect and suppress fires in buildings, providing a crucial layer of protection for occupants and property. The use of insulation pins in these systems serves multiple purposes, including temperature control, freeze protection, and structural support.

Fire sprinkler systems typically use water as the primary fire suppression agent. The pipes that carry this water must be maintained at a specific temperature to ensure that the system operates correctly when needed. In cold climates, the risk of pipes freezing and bursting is a significant concern. Insulation pins are used to support the insulation material that helps to maintain the temperature of the water in the pipes, preventing them from freezing and ensuring that the system remains functional.

In addition to freeze protection, insulation pins for fire sprinkler systems also help to control the temperature of the water in hot climates. Excessive heat can cause the water to expand, leading to increased pressure in the pipes and the potential for leaks or bursts. Proper insulation and support with insulation pins can help to maintain a stable temperature, reducing the risk of these issues and ensuring that the system operates reliably.

Insulation pins for fire sprinkler systems must also be able to withstand the mechanical stresses of the system. Fire sprinkler pipes are often installed in tight spaces and may be subject to vibrations and movements caused by the flow of water. Insulation pins that are durable and flexible can provide stable support while allowing for some movement, reducing the risk of damage to the pipes and insulation. This is particularly important in large commercial and industrial buildings where fire sprinkler systems may cover extensive areas.

Another critical aspect of insulation pins for fire sprinkler systems is their ability to resist corrosion. Fire sprinkler systems are often exposed to moisture and chemicals, which can cause corrosion and degradation of the pipes and supports. Insulation pins made from corrosion-resistant materials, such as stainless steel or coated carbon steel, can withstand these conditions and provide long-lasting support. Regular maintenance and inspection of the insulation pins are essential to ensure that they remain in good condition and continue to perform their intended function.
